Casement windows are the UK's default style - hinged on the side, opening outward. In uPVC they're the cheapest window to replace and the fastest to fit. If your existing frames are pre-2005 or single-glazed, A-rated casements typically pay back in energy savings within 8-12 years.
The single biggest price driver is glass area, not the exact frame - a 1200x1200mm casement costs roughly the same in white uPVC or a basic foiled finish, but jumps for triple glazing or a flush-sash profile. Standard installs use argon-filled double glazing with a warm-edge spacer; upgrading to triple glazing adds around 15% for a marginal thermal gain in most UK climates.
Popular specs for casement windows
Argon-filled A-rated double glazing, 28mm sealed unit, warm-edge spacer, low-E soft coat, multi-point locking, internally beaded, trickle vents (mandatory since June 2022).
Windows and doors in Perth - local context
Sandstone Victorian tenements and villas around the city centre, Georgian townhouses along Marshall Place, plus interwar bungalows in Craigie and Bridgend.
Dominant era of housing stock: Victorian sandstone.
Heritage note: Around 10 conservation areas including Perth Central and Kinnoull Hill.
